The 2024 vintage is a great vintage in my view, even better than anyone expected, I think.
The harvesting window was presumably better than the previous hot vintages – mainly thinking of 2023, where some wines were rather cooked in the phenolics.
The 2024 is a much cooler vintage, and the phenolics are in many cases close to perfect, and some are perhaps on the slightly underriper side.
In general, Thibault Morey is spot on, and this is for me the best vintage I have tasted in the almost 10 years I have visited this beautiful estate. Great cheers and a hurray to all at Domaine Morey-Coffinet … such beautiful and effortless hedonistic treats.
Amazing that such beautiful wines could come from this rather mediocre year and difficult climate. The whites from 2024 are, in general, a huge positive surprise with unique qualities.
The year 2024 was wet and relatively cold, and left the vignerons with a lot of problems where mildew and pouriture gris were the worst. The whites seem to have escaped the worst, and those who have sorted well have produced some beautiful whites … both Chardonnay and Aligoté.
The alcohol level is relatively low … often low to mid 12% … and then boosted to 12,8 – 13,2% with the sugar (chaptalisation).
The ripeness is on spot, or a bit below phenolic-wise… and yes, in theory, some could feel that the phenolics should be a bit riper on average … but I am not sure I agree.
These years we have too many whites tasting like sweet Chardonnay fruit soup, with no tension and energy, just this dense yellow fruit … I must say I prefer the slightly underripe version found in some 2024.
The advantage in 2024 is furthermore a low alcohol level, that give the wines an effortless feel and harmonious style … as the high alcohol is not blocking the fine taste of the Chardonnay grapes … this is rare these days!

Domaine Morey-Coffinet Bourgogne Côte de Or 2024
The Bourgogne Blanc – now Côte d’Or is an effortless delight. Elegant and delicate with only 12,5% of alcohol. So relaxed, vivid and effortless with an almost zen-like calmness. What a treat!
(Drink From 2026) – Very Good – (88p) – ![]()
